The football girdle is for the hip pads & tail bone pad. It has pockets inside them for these pads. It looks like compression shorts.
Take out all the pads and then wash the girdle just like any other clothing. When done put the pads back in the right pockets.
yeahh it is necessary, not wearing a girdle leaves your hips open to helmets and anything else, the hip or side is a very frequent spot where the football player will take a hit by a helmet, plus landing on your side after getting hit or jumping for a ball is alot less painful if you have your girdle w/hip pads on. It also helps to keep your thigh pads in place if your girdle has pad pockets in them which i have found is a lot easier.

A sports girdle is an article of clothing worn under a uniform that has pockets for pads. Girdles are worn by football players and have pockets for hip, tailbone, and thigh pads. Protection and clothing you would find on a football player would include a helmet with a face mask and chin strap, mouth guard, shoulder pads, collar pads, neck pad or roll, forearm pads, a flak jacket or some sort of rib protection, hip pads, a girdle over an athletic supporter and cup, tailbone pads, thigh pads, knee pads, and cleats. Over all this padding would go the jersey top and pants.
